Best Ann Arbor Neighborhoods for UMich Students
Central Campus is the most popular area for students — walking distance to most UMich buildings and well-served by buses. Kerrytown offers a more neighborhood feel just north of campus. Burns Park and East Ann Arbor attract upperclassmen and grad students who prefer quieter residential streets and slightly more space.
University of michigan student housing ann arbor: What to Budget
University of Michigan student housing in Ann Arbor near Central Campus typically runs $1,200–$1,800/month for a 1-bedroom. Shared 2–3 bedroom units average $750–$1,100/person. Kerrytown and Burns Park are similar in price. Ann Arbor has a very competitive market — plan to secure your lease by February for fall availability.
Tips for Renting Near UMich
The Ann Arbor rental market is competitive — begin searching in January for fall units.
Check AATA bus routes to campus if you're living farther from Central Campus.
Confirm heat and utility costs before committing; Michigan winters are long and expensive.
Look into rooming houses near campus — they offer furnished options at competitive per-person rates.
